It doesn't take much to keep them around unless you're playing 10+ hours a day and they recharge all their energy overnight, so you can play all day while using those and when you wake up the next day they are completely full again.

They are well worth the effort of using considering what they can offer, you can go with passive stats that give resist depending on which relic you use (Each one has their own element along with their own element resist although i'm not sure if there's a relic based on chaos with chaos resist).. They also have damage increase perks that are active when you have them active but those damage increase perks/stats are for the relic itself if i'm correct... Each and every relic has 3 different skills with their own sub bonusses that you can pick from.

And no, you don't have to dump money into them to keep em around.. You can use ingame gold to fill them up if you want to.

Charms, you combine until you get level 5 or 6's you want. Dont both identifying anything lower or you'll run out of scrolls quick. Combine 1,1,2 to get a 3, and 2,2,3 to get a 4, etc. You get a 33% chance of upgrading this way, but SAVE 2 of the higher level charms for another attempt. If you're overloaded with them, combining all 3 of the same I THINK is an automatic upgrade, but I do the 2 lows 1 high method until I have a bunch of 6's to identify.
